Why solar?
The installer calculates that the addition of this commercial solar solution to the K’ómoks First Nation administration building will offset approximately 35% of the building's electrical energy requirements. This will contribute to significant operational cost savings over the lifetime of the system, as well as reducing emissions by 534 metric tons of carbon dioxide (CO₂) annually—equivalent to greenhouse gas emissions from 119 gas-powered vehicles driven for one year, or to 104 homes' electricity use for one year, per the EPA.
